Flex Streamline for power

Flex Streamline provides complete flexibility on commodity purchasing, with full support from our market-leading Optimisation Desk. Consumption that falls outside standard base and peak-load blocks is covered by a pre-agreed shape premium. A forecasted invoicing rate is set to aid invoice validation, with a monthly reconciliation to ensure an accurate final purchase price.

Flex Innovate for power and gas

A contract designed for sophisticated commercial energy procurement, providing all the usual benefits of flexible purchasing while allowing you to pay a published index price for any difference between your tradable blocks and actual consumption. With shape transparently priced and the need for contractual volume tolerances removed, you will pay for exactly what you use.

With net zero on the horizon, finding ways to reduce emissions is more important than ever in business energy procurement. Perhaps the simplest way is to opt for carbon-free supply.

Our UK Business Renewable energy and our UK Renewable Pure energy provide independently-verified sustainable power that’s fully compliant for zero GHG Scope 2 market-based reporting. 

It works by matching the power you consume with the equivalent volume of renewable power supplied to the grid. We evidence this by securing the corresponding number of Renewable Energy Guarantees of Origin (REGO) certificates, which are issued for each megawatt-hour (MWh) of renewable generation fed into the UK electricity system.

What is business energy procurement?

Business energy procurement is the process of buying, planning and managing business energy for your organisation. It involves choosing the right contract structure, deciding when to buy energy, understanding market risk and managing costs such as non-commodity charges. A strong business energy procurement strategy can help improve budget visibility, reduce exposure to market volatility and support wider operational and net zero goals.

What is the difference between fixed and flexible energy procurement?

The main difference between fixed and flexible energy procurement is how and when your energy price is secured. Fixed energy procurement usually means agreeing your business energy price for the contract term, giving you more certainty over your costs. Flexible energy procurement means buying energy in stages rather than fixing everything at one point in time. This can help spread risk, create more opportunities to achieve a market-reflective price and give your business more control over its energy buying strategy.
